Understanding RTP, volatility, and payout dynamics in new online casinos
When evaluating games at new online casinos you should distinguish long term expectations from short term results. RTP, or return to player, indicates the theoretical percentage of wagered money a game returns over an extended period. It is a mathematical property of the game and not a promise of winnings on a given session. Volatility or variance describes how much a game’s results deviate from the expected RTP. A low volatility game pays smaller amounts more frequently, while a high volatility title offers bigger wins but less often. Hit frequency is a practical measure players can use to understand how often a game tends to land any win. Payout distribution adds nuance by showing how often wins occur in different sizes, including jackpots and smaller prizes. In the context of new online casinos, you will often see a mix of games with varying RTP ranges and volatility levels. Always check the game information panel for the listed RTP, and remember that the published numbers reflect long term averages, not sure things for a single spin or hand.
- RTP is usually expressed as a percentage over many rounds, not a guaranteed return in your session.
- Volatility helps you plan bankroll and betting strategy based on your risk tolerance.
- Hit frequency and payout distribution influence how a session feels and how quickly you can recoup losses.

Bonus mechanics and wagering rules at new online casinos
Bonuses are a central feature of new online casinos but come with specific mechanics that can influence your real outcome. Common bonus types include matched deposit offers, free spins, and cashback. Wagering requirements dictate how many times you must play the bonus amount before withdrawal. Game weighting reveals that different games contribute differently to meeting these requirements. For instance, slots might count at full value while table games contribute a smaller percentage or nothing at all. Maximum bet rules during bonus play cap how much you can wager per spin or hand, which can limit risk when chasing big wins. Expiry dates specify how long you have to meet wagering conditions, and withdrawal restrictions may apply to bonus funds. It is crucial to read the fine print of any offer including terms on eligibility, country restrictions, and game weighting. In new online casinos you should track these details and avoid placing large bets that could jeopardize your ability to meet wagering requirements.
- Confirm which games contribute to wagering requirements and at what rate.
- Check expiry dates to ensure you have enough time to meet playthrough goals.
- Watch for caps on winnings or limits on the number of free spins per day or week.

Deposits, withdrawals, payment methods, processing times, and limits at new online casinos
Payment flows are a practical dimension of any gambling site. New online casinos typically offer a mix of methods such as debit and credit cards, e-wallets, bank transfers, and sometimes prepaid solutions. Processing times vary by method: instant or near instant for e-wallets, a few hours to a few days for bank transfers, and days for some card payments depending on the issuer and country. Limits on deposits and withdrawals are also important to review, including daily, weekly, and monthly caps. Fees may apply for certain methods or currency conversions. Always verify whether a method supports fast withdrawals to your location and whether there are any withdrawal verification requirements that could delay access to funds. In the context of new online casinos, staying informed about how funds move helps you plan bets and manage liquidity while enjoying the platform.
- Compare supported payment methods and their processing times for deposits and withdrawals.
- Check for withdrawal limits and any fees that could apply to your transactions.
- Be aware of potential delays caused by verification steps or bank processing cycles.
